What they do
A Waiter or Waitress takes orders and serves food and beverages to customers in restaurants. Answers customer questions about menu items, prepares checks and collects payment, and assists with clearing dishes and tables. May work in banquet or dining halls.

Responsibilities Take accurate food and beverage orders, utilizing POS system. Serve food and drinks efficiently while maintaining high standards of presentation, food safety, and sanitation. Manage guest inquiries, address concerns promptly, and ensure overall guest satisfaction through attentive service. Assist with food handling, bussing tables, and maintaining cleanliness in dining areas to uphold sanitation standards. Collaborate with kitchen staff to coordinate timely delivery of orders, ensuring accuracy and quality. Maintain knowledge of the menu including daily specials, dietary restrictions, and beverage options to inform guests accurately. Handle cash transactions accurately, perform basic math calculations for bills, and process payments using POS systems responsibly.
